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re uncertain whether or not your pipes require relining, here are a few signs to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Bad odors coming from your drains
  • There are gurgling sounds co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Is It Best To Have My Pipe Relined or Replaced?

That is a question that homeowners from all walks of life will have to consider at time. Relining and replacement both are a choice with advantages and disadvantages, so it isn’t easy to determine which option is best for you. Here are a few things to consider:

Relining

  • Relining is cheaper than replacement.
  • It is possible to do it without tearing your walls or floor.
  • It can be done quickly generally in the span of a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to make after the job has been completed.
  • The new liner will last for a long time.

Replacement

  • Replacement is more expensive than Relining.
  • It’s a messy job and you might require to vacate you home for a couple of days during the time it is being done.
  • The new pipe will last for a long time.

Can You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

Yes trenchless pipe relining is a great no dig solution to repair damaged pipes with bends in their pipe. The process of pipe relining creates a new pipe in the existing pipe. This means that you won’t have to tear out the old pipe and will be able to fix it without digging up your yard or driveway.

The difficultness of a pipe relining job increases with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ts has replaced many sewer line pipes with bends in them.

Although it’s a challenge,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and know-how to get the project done right.

Will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ees Getting Into My Sewer?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ining solutions can be used to prevent tree roots from entering your sewer. Sliplining creates a new pipe within the existing one. It helps seal off any openings, cracks or holes that may allow tree roots to gain access to.

Also, regular maintenance and cleaning of your sewer line can assist in stopping tree roots from getting into them.

What Is The Difference Between Pipe Replacement and Pipe Relining?

Pipe relining is the process of creating a new pipe inside an old one, while replacement causes the pipe to break and replaces it with a new one.

Pipe relining is generally less invasive and can be a more affordable alternative to pipe replacement. Speak to a specialist regarding your particular requirements to determine which option will work best for you.

Will Pipe Relining Affect Pipe Flow?

There is rarely a decrease in the flow of pipe in the event of the relining of pipes. In fact, pipe relining can increase the amount of flow that flows through the pipe since it creates the new smooth area for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Used For?

Pipe relining was used for quite a while, the first instance of its use being in 1854.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000’s that it was beginning to become more commonplace.

Today, pipe relining technology is utilised all over the world as a reliable solution to fix leaky or damaged pipes without having to dig them up and replace them entirely. There are many different types of pipe relining solutions that are available dependent on the kind of pipe and the degree to which the pipe is damaged.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Kalorama, which is utilised for leaks of a small size, and structural pipe relining which is used for more severe damage. Whichever type of pipe relining used however, the purpose remains the same: to fix the pipe without having to replace it entirely.

This option that doesn’t require digging will save time and money in addition, it is also a more eco-friendly option than relocating the pipe.
